Output c52b18000c30f1938dee6f55d8cd83d5423b6285bb08d34e3442815280292a50:1

value
660168095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44d03d2c4543a5dc25fc149be6f8c773529b2070 OP_EQUAL
address
37xsLHTcufCoxsQCTcaGSEKnXcTniDREVE
transaction
c52b18000c30f1938dee6f55d8cd83d5423b6285bb08d34e3442815280292a50
confirmations
371865
spent
true